What an Incognito Casino Usually Means

The term “incognito casino” is often used to describe a gambling website designed to minimise unnecessary exposure of personal information. This can involve limited marketing tracking, discreet account settings, secure payment processing, and a clear explanation of how customer data is stored.

It does not normally mean that a casino can ignore identity checks. Reputable operators must follow applicable anti-money-laundering and responsible-gambling requirements. A player may therefore be asked for proof of identity, address, or payment ownership before a withdrawal is completed. Privacy is about responsible data handling, not avoiding lawful verification.

Key Features Worth Comparing

A useful review should examine several areas at once. One attractive bonus cannot compensate for weak withdrawal terms or unclear ownership information. Compare operators against consistent criteria before registering.

Area What to check Why it matters
Licensing Regulator, licence details, and jurisdiction Shows whether the operator is accountable
Data protection Privacy policy, encryption, and marketing controls Explains how personal information is handled
Payments Available methods, fees, limits, and processing times Reduces surprises when depositing or withdrawing
Game fairness Recognised software providers and testing information Supports confidence in random results
Player support Live chat, email, response times, and complaint routes Provides help when an issue occurs

Privacy Without Losing Practical Protection

Players should look beyond visual design. A secure casino should use HTTPS, protect account credentials, and limit access to sensitive information. Its privacy notice should explain the purposes of data collection, retention periods, third-party sharing, and the choices available to customers.

Consider using a unique password and enabling two-factor authentication where offered. Avoid saving payment details on shared devices, keep software updated, and review promotional permissions after opening an account. These simple habits reduce risks that no casino interface can eliminate entirely.

  • Read the privacy and cookie policies before registering.
  • Check whether marketing messages can be disabled.
  • Use a payment method that gives suitable transaction visibility.
  • Keep copies of deposit, withdrawal, and support records.
  • Never share login details, verification documents, or one-time codes.

Bonuses, Wagering Rules, and Withdrawals

Privacy-focused branding should not distract from bonus mathematics. Examine the wagering requirement, eligible games, maximum bet, contribution percentages, expiry period, and maximum convertible winnings. A promotion with a large headline value may be less useful than a smaller offer with transparent conditions.

Withdrawal rules deserve equal attention. Check minimum and maximum amounts, pending periods, verification requirements, and any administrative charges. If a casino repeatedly delays reasonable withdrawals or changes conditions without clear notice, that is a significant warning sign regardless of its privacy claims.

Responsible Play Is Part of a Good Review

A trustworthy casino should make safer-gambling tools easy to find. Useful controls may include deposit limits, session reminders, cooling-off periods, self-exclusion, and access to spending history. These tools are most effective when set before play becomes difficult to manage.

Set a budget based on disposable income and treat every wager as entertainment expenditure. Do not chase losses, borrow money to gamble, or increase stakes to recover a poor session. If gambling stops feeling controlled, pause immediately and contact an appropriate support service.
